Darrenjo said:thats interesting....thanks for that, less hassle chasing 1 company rather than 2
The way it seems to have worked so far for me is;
1) I eventually had a notification from Ryanair that the flight was cancelled, and options with them to rebook or refund. It seems to me that this came through bang on a fortnight before the outbound flight date.
2) Going on the LH web page their FAQs ask you to inform them if you are notified directly (as the traveller) of a flight change/cancellation.
3) When I went to "Manage my booking" on LH to notify them it asked if I have confirmed a refund is requested with the flight operator. This is a tick box that is compulsory before you can click the submit button. Effectively, it forces you to request the refund.
4) Going back to the Ryanair page, I clicked the relevant buttons and asked for a refund for all travellers/flights. Their confirmation page says that the payment will be refunded directly back to the original payment method within 20 days. As I paid LH for everything, I assume this will go back to them (if it happens).
5) I went back to LH, clicked through again and checked the box that I have requested a refund from Ryanair.
6) I now patiently await notification from LH. Now that they have been informed (by me) that the flight is cancelled, they should in theory also arrange a refund of the accommodation (which is also shut for the whole summer, but that's another story) as the other part of my package holiday.
7) I'm trying to get a customer service chat session with LH but nothing is happening.
I think I'm doing it by the book, but we'll see. It seems confusing because you book the whole package with LH but Ryanair contact the traveller directly, and not the booker/payer. What's more, the within 20 days bit would seem to make it very hard for LH to refund people within the regulated 14 days without stumping up their own money. Maybe this is behind the whole RCN thing, otherwise the cashflow would bankrupt them in no time. To be fair, if I could actually reach a human being I would agree to an extended and reasonable amount of time to process the refund.
See how it goes.
